file-type

2007下半年数据库系统工程师下午考试试卷解析

下载需积分: 0 | 434KB | 更新于2024-12-31 | 50 浏览量 | 0 下载量 举报 收藏
download 立即下载
"全国计算机技术与软件专业技术资格(水平)考试2007年下半年 数据库系统工程师 下午试卷" 本文档是一份2007年下半年全国计算机技术与软件专业技术资格(水平)考试的数据库系统工程师下午试卷。考试时间为14:00至16:30,共计150分钟,试卷包含5道必答题,每题15分,总分为75分。考生需要在答题纸上按要求填写个人信息,并严格按照题目要求作答,确保字迹清晰,否则可能无法得分。 试卷中给出了一个关于成绩管理系统的案例分析。该系统用于管理高校学生的平时成绩和考试成绩,涉及的主要功能包括: 1. 课程由多个单元组成,每个单元结束后会有测试,测试成绩作为平时成绩。 2. 成绩由主讲教师上传至系统。 3. 系统通过验证学生信息、课程信息和单元信息来确认成绩的有效性。 4. 有效成绩保存在课程成绩文件中,无效成绩保存在无效成绩文件,并报告给教务处。 5. 当一门课程所有有效成绩齐全,系统会通知教务处,可生成成绩列表供考试委员会审查。 6. 在生成成绩列表前,系统会先生成成绩报告给主讲教师核对。 7. 主讲教师核对后返回成绩报告,系统据此操作。 从这个案例中,我们可以提炼出以下与数据库系统工程相关的知识点: 1. 数据库设计:成绩管理系统涉及到学生、课程、单元、成绩等多个实体及其关系,需要进行数据库设计,包括实体建模、关系建模和数据完整性约束。 2. 数据验证:系统对成绩进行有效性验证,体现了数据库的完整性规则,如外键约束,确保成绩与选课信息匹配。 3. 数据存储:课程成绩和无效成绩分别存储在不同的文件中,这涉及到数据的分类存储和管理策略。 4. 数据操作:系统的功能涵盖了数据的添加、查询、更新和删除操作,这是数据库操作的基础。 5. 数据安全与隐私:系统需保护学生的个人信息和成绩,体现了数据库的安全性和隐私保护措施。 6. 数据交互:系统与主讲教师和教务处之间的信息交换,涉及数据库系统的接口设计和数据传输协议。 7. 数据报表:成绩报告的生成,反映了数据库的查询和报表生成能力,以及可能用到的SQL查询和报表工具。 8. 数据处理流程:从数据输入到报告反馈,体现了数据库系统中的业务流程管理和工作流设计。 9. 数据一致性:主讲教师的核对过程保证了数据库中数据的一致性,避免错误的录入。 10. 数据通信:系统与外部部门(如教务处)的通信,涉及到网络通信技术和数据交换标准。 以上知识点体现了数据库系统工程师在实际工作中需要掌握的核心技能和概念,包括数据库设计、数据管理、系统集成以及业务流程的理解和实现。

相关推荐

zhuanyeshixi
  • 粉丝: 0
上传资源 快速赚钱